It was a spectacular night for the drum aficionados in attendance at Guitar Center’s 27th Annual Drum-Off. Finalists Hilario Bell, Jonathan Burks, Luis Burgos Jr, Brandon Zackey, and Tony Taylor, Jr. competed on the Club Nokia stage for this year’s title, $25,000 in cash plus an assortment of gear and perks. There were artist performances by Taylor Hawkins (Foo Fighters), Mike Mangini (Dream Theater) Robert Sput Searight (Snarky Puppy, Ghost-Note), Clyde Stubblefield (James Brown), and Gil Sharone (Marilyn Manson, Team Sleep). The late musician and drum product company founder Vic Firth was inducted into Guitar Center’s Hollywood Rockwalk. Red Hot Chili Peppers’ drummer Chad Smith showed up to introduce session drummer Jim Keltner to the audience before Keltner pressed his hands in cement. At the end of the night, host Gregg Bissonette (David Lee Roth, Joe Satriani) announced Tony Taylor, Jr. from Matteson, Illinois as the winner of this year’s competition.
